    RESPONSIBILITIES

    Develop and execute underwriting strategies, policies, and procedures to reduce risk and achieve business objectives.

    Collaborate with partners to align underwriting practices with company goals and trends.

    Oversee the underwriting process and access risk associated with client applications and other financial products.

    Determine decisions regarding approvals, denials or modifications based on risk analysis and specific guidelines.

    Monitor and manage the underwriting portfolio, tracking key metrics, identifying trends, and implementing corrective actions to mitigate risks and maximize profitability.

    Build and maintain effective relationships with internal and external stakeholders to ensure seamless coordination of underwriting activities.

    Comply with regulatory requirements, industry standards and company policies throughout the underwriting process.

    Conduct audits to review the accuracy and completeness of underwriting decisions.

    Remain informed of market trends and underwriting practices.

    Performs additional duties as assigned by the CCO and or CEO in support of business operations.
